Abu Ali Al Ashary, from Muhammad Bin Abdul Jabbar, from Safwan Bin Yahya, from one of his companions, from Abu Baseer, (It has been narrated) from Abu Abdullah asws regarding a man upon whom the proof is established of his having commited adultery, then he flees before he is whipped. He asws said: ‘So if he repents, there is nothing upon him, and if he falls in the hands of the Imam asws , he asws would establish the Penalty ( Hadd ) upon him, and if his whereabouts are known, he asws would send (a summoner) to him’.
